Experience the freedom of the open road in Romania as you embark on an unforgettable 9-day road trip! This experience caters to every traveler, featuring destinations like Sibiu, Sighișoara, Brasov, Bran, Rasnov, Dâmbovicioara, Sinaia, Bucharest, Curtea de Argeș, and Arefu.

This perfectly planned road trip itinerary in Romania takes you through some of the best places to see in the country. You will spend 3 nights in Sibiu, 1 night in Sighișoara, 2 nights in Brasov, 1 night in Sinaia, and 1 night in Bucharest.
